Exhibit Opening | Electric, Steam, or Gasoline

Electric, Steam, or Gasoline | About the Exhibit

Today’s automobile designers and manufacturers are focused on adjusting to increased demands for power and fuel alternatives. The hope is that pollutant-free, long range, and efficient vehicles are just over the horizon.

But that’s not new!

As the Twentieth Century dawned, only 20% of American cars ran on gasoline! Come to the Crawford Auto-Aviation Museum and see over 100 years of technological innovation. Learn how our current thoughts regarding the future of transportation are firmly rooted in a fascinating past.

About the exhibit:

Si Jolie! is about French fashion and all of the stories in between. It highlights how Paris fashion motivated Clevelanders to travel abroad, influenced local fashion, inspired the golden age of department stores, and how significant fashion was socially. Guests who visit this new exhibition will travel back in time and experience how fashion and travel have evolved over the years and how similar Clevelanders then were to those living here today.

Behind The Scenes: 75th Anniversary of D-Day

Thursday, June 6th marks the 75th anniversary of the D-Day landings in Normandy, France. The Allied invasion of occupied Europe marked a turning point in World War II and was a crucial step in the defeat of Nazi Germany. Join WRHS Chief Curator Eric Rivet for a discussion of the planning and preparations that made D-Day successful and the experiences of the men that fought the battle. You will also have an opportunity to examine and handle the kinds of uniforms and equipment used by the US Army on that fateful day.
